Los Gatos, California, United States of America
21 hours ago
Software Engineer (L5) - Open Connect Control Plane, Live

Netflix is one of the world's leading entertainment services, with 283 million paid memberships in over 190 countries enjoying TV series, films and games across a wide variety of genres and languages. Members can play, pause and resume watching as much as they want, anytime, anywhere, and can change their plans at any time.

Netflix has been changing the way people watch shows and movies and we've built a global Content Delivery Network called Open Connect, which sets the standard for video delivery.  We’ve recently embarked on a journey to stream our content live, which comes with an exciting variety of opportunities and technical challenges.

To embrace those challenges, we are looking to add a software engineer to the Open Connect Control Plane team to craft the scalable, reliable systems needed to build the best Live experience possible.

The role involves building:

Cloud services that customers directly hit when they press ‘Play’

Algorithms for steering customers to Netflix Live hardware such that they have the best possible Quality-of-Experience, taking into account network topology, system load and other factors

Systems that smartly direct how Open Connect caching appliances fill from each other to deliver a Live stream from origin to the edge

Load-balancing algorithms for optimizing hardware utilization

Operational knobs and tools to quickly diagnose and fix problems as they arise: when you’re doing it live, every second counts!

We spend our time trying to answer questions like these:

What do we need to build in order to handle the biggest Live streaming event ever?

How do we design our systems to react to failure, traffic shifts and other changes in real-time?

What’s the best way to share system capacity between Live and VOD traffic?

How do we make our Live systems easy to operate?

We are looking for someone who identifies with the following: 

You build robust and scalable distributed systems.

You are comfortable with ambiguity.

You are able to iterate quickly on ideas and incorporate feedback.

You care about building quality software that your teammates can support. 

You have a passion for operational excellence

You believe that fostering an inclusive environment helps everyone do their best work.

Basic Qualifications:

7+ years software development or proficiency with a modern programming language

Experience building and operating business-critical systems at scale

Distributed Systems experience (e.g. building stateful & stateless systems, experiencewith Casandra, Kafka, etc)

Nice To Have:

Live streaming experience

Basic background in networking concepts

Big Data Experience (e.g. Hive, Spark, Presto, etc.)

Experience with ML or optimization algorithms

At Netflix, we carefully consider a wide range of compensation factors to determine your personal top of the market. We rely on market indicators to determine compensation and consider your specific job family, background, skills, and experience to get it right. These considerations can cause your compensation to vary and will also be dependent on your location. 
 

Our compensation structure consists solely of an annual salary; we do not have bonuses. You choose each year how much of your compensation you want in salary versus stock options. To determine your personal top of market compensation, we rely on market indicators and consider your specific job family, background, skills, and experience to determine your compensation in the market range. The range for this role is $100,000 - $720,000.

Inclusion is a Netflix value and we strive to host a meaningful interview experience for all candidates. If you want an accommodation/adjustment for a disability or any other reason during the hiring process, please send a request to your recruiting partner.

We are an equal-opportunity employer and celebrate diversity, recognizing that diversity builds stronger teams. We approach diversity and inclusion seriously and thoughtfully. We do not discriminate on the basis of race, religion, color, ancestry, national origin, caste, sex, sexual orientation, gender, gender identity or expression, age, disability, medical condition, pregnancy, genetic makeup, marital status, or military service.

Por favor confirme su dirección de correo electrónico: Send Email